History Behind Santa Claus

Saint Nicholas was born in the late third century AD in what’s now modern-day Turkey. He was more than just a bishop-he was the original ‘saint-ational' Christmas cheerleader. Despite facing Roman government persecution for his faith in Christ that ‘snowball'-ed during his youth, Nicholas rose through the ranks faster than Rudolph’s red nose lighting up the night sky.

Fast forward to the Council of Nicaea in AD 325, where Nicholas found himself in the middle of a theological “snow”-storm. In a “claus”-hanging moment, he decided to settle the dispute not with milk and cookies but with a good ol’ face fist fight, proving that even saints can pack a punch when it comes to defending our heavenly Father.

But it wasn’t all about fisticuffs for Saint Nicholas-his generosity was the stuff of legendary tales. Picture this: three young girls saved from servitude with a bag of money he left on their doorstep in the middle of the night. It was also believed he sprung three young men from wrongful imprisonment and sailors shouting, ‘Saint Nicholas, help us!' even when he was nowhere near the sea. Talk about a sleigh ride of miracles!

A Christmas Legend

Officially canonized in the 10th century, Saint Nicholas became a sensational figure, surviving the period of saint veneration during the Protestant Reformation. Even in the face of changing times, his popularity endured like a timeless Christmas carol. This history behind Santa Claus is certainly inspiring!
